前端性能测试工具推荐

星辰之舞酱 2024-01-07 ⋅ 23 阅读

在开发前端应用程序时,性能是至关重要的因素。一个性能良好的前端应用不仅可以提供更好的用户体验,还可以提高网站的搜索排名并吸引更多的访问者。为了评估和优化前端应用程序的性能,我们可以使用各种性能测试工具。在本文中,我们将介绍一些受欢迎且功能丰富的前端性能测试工具。

1. Lighthouse

Lighthouse 是一个由 Google 开发的开源工具,可用于评估 Web 应用程序的质量和性能。它提供了一些有用的指标,如网站的加载速度、性能优化建议、可访问性评估和最佳实践指南等。Lighthouse 可以通过 Google Chrome 的开发者工具使用,也可以通过命令行工具进行自动化测试。

Lighthouse 可以帮助我们检测并解决一些常见的前端性能问题,比如资源压缩和缓存、可访问性问题、网络请求的优化等。它还提供了一张综合的性能报告,可以帮助我们更好地了解应用程序的性能表现。

2. WebPageTest

WebPageTest 是一个免费的在线性能测试工具,可以帮助我们评估网站的加载速度和性能。它提供了全球各地的测试节点,可以模拟不同地理位置的用户体验。

WebPageTest 可以提供详细的性能报告,包括加载时间、页面组件的加载顺序、渲染性能等。它还提供了一些高级功能,比如对比测试和视频回放,可以帮助我们更好地理解和分析网站的性能。

3. GTmetrix

GTmetrix 是另一个流行的在线性能测试工具,可以评估网站的加载速度和性能。它可以模拟不同的设备和连接速度,以便更好地了解用户的体验。

GTmetrix 提供了多个性能指标,包括页面加载时间、资源加载时间、HTTP 请求等。它还提供了一些优化建议,可以帮助我们改进网站的性能。

4. PageSpeed Insights

PageSpeed Insights 是一个由 Google 提供的在线性能测试工具,可以帮助我们评估网站的性能并提供改进建议。它提供了针对移动设备和桌面设备的性能评估,并给出了相应的优化建议。

PageSpeed Insights 提供了一些常见的性能指标,如加载时间、资源加载顺序、用户体验评分等。它还提供了一些可以优化网站性能的具体建议,如图片压缩、资源缓存、代码压缩等。

5. SpeedCurve

SpeedCurve 是一个专业的前端性能监控和分析工具,可以帮助我们实时监测网站的性能,并提供详细的分析报告。它可以监控页面加载时间、渲染性能、关键交互事件等。

SpeedCurve 提供了一些高级功能,如比较测试、回放功能和性能趋势分析等。它还可以与其他监控工具和版本控制系统集成,以实现更全面的性能监控和分析。

这些都是一些功能丰富且受欢迎的前端性能测试工具。它们可以帮助我们评估和优化前端应用程序的性能,从而提供更好的用户体验和搜索排名。无论您是开发人员还是网站拥有者,都可以选择适合您需求的工具来提升网站的性能。


全部评论: 0

    我有话说: